If you’re staying at Smuggs, this is by far one of your best options anywhere in the area for a nicer, higher-end meal, by I would go as far to say this place is worth the drive even from Stowe - The Family Table is just as good, if not better, than most restaurants on that side of the Notch! Jeffersonville has a hidden gem, and you’d never expect it driving past the restaurant. They have an excellent selection of pizzas (red and white sauce), pastas (which can all be made gluten-free), cuts of meat (chicken, pork, lamb, steak, etc.), New American-style small plates, seafood, soups, salads, and SO MUCH more! They have something for every type of palette, and this is why it’s called “The Family Table” - you can bring your family here and everyone will leave satisfied. We particularly loved the dry-aged grilled ribeye, maple pork chop, fried calamari, blackened shrimp, and lobster tiger rolls. I don’t even like pork chops very much because they’re normally very bland and dry (and just don’t taste that great), but I would willingly order that maple pork chop almost every time I come here - it’s THAT good. They have a really nice selection of small plates, so be sure to get a few and share with your table. And, you gotta get at least one pizza! Scrofae Pepe e Ciplolla, Tre Porcellini, Vermonter…you really can’t go wrong.
